Topsoil spreading services involve the careful distribution of quality soil across lawns, gardens, or landscaped areas. This process typically starts with preparing the existing ground, which may include leveling or removing debris, to ensure an even and stable surface. Once prepared, professional contractors spread the topsoil evenly to create a healthy foundation for grass growth, plantings, or new landscaping features. Proper topsoil application can improve soil fertility, promote healthy plant development, and enhance the overall appearance of a property.
These services help address common problems such as soil erosion, poor drainage, and compacted or nutrient-deficient soil. For properties experiencing uneven terrain or areas where grass struggles to grow, spreading fresh topsoil can provide a better environment for root development and plant vitality. Additionally, topsoil spreading can be part of larger landscaping projects, helping to level out slopes or fill in low spots that may cause water pooling or aesthetic issues. The overview below groups typical Topsoil Spreading proj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Kitsap County, WA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Small-scale Projects - Typically, costs range from $250 to $600 for routine topsoil spreading on smaller lawns or garden beds. Many local contractors handle these jobs efficiently within this middle range. Fewer projects fall into the highest cost tier for minor repairs or touch-ups.
Medium-sized Jobs - Larger residential areas or landscaping projects usually cost between $600 and $1,500. These projects often involve spreading several yards of topsoil across a moderate area. Costs can vary based on soil depth and site accessibility.
Large or Complex Projects - For extensive landscaping, new lawn installations, or significant site prep, costs can range from $1,500 to $3,500 or more. Larger, more involved jobs tend to push into higher price brackets, especially if additional site preparation is required.
Full Replacement or Major Landscaping - Complete topsoil replacement or large-scale landscaping projects can reach $3,500 to $5,000+ depending on the size and complexity. These higher-end projects are less common but represent the full scope of topsoil spreading services available from local service providers.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
